Can Tai Chi Ease Arthritis? Discover Its Benefits For Arthritis Sufferers!

Tai chi is a gentle form of exercise that originated in ancient China and is often recommended for people with arthritis. It combines slow, flowing movements with deep breathing and mental focus, offering multiple benefits for those dealing with the challenges of arthritis.

Can Tai Chi Ease Arthritis Pain?

Tai chi's gentle and flowing movements can be a real game – changer for arthritis pain. The slow,controlled motions help to increase the range of motion in joints affected by arthritis. For instance t ai chi for arthritis , when you perform the circular arm movements in tai chi,the should joins gradually become more flexible. This flexibility reduces the friction between the bones Tai Chi Courses Online , which in turn eases the pain. Many of my students with arthritis have reported a significant decrease in their daily pain levels after a few months of regular tai chi practice.

How Does Tai Chi Improve Mobility?

t ai chi for arthritis

Improving mobility is a cruel aspect for arthritis patients, and tai chi does it remarkably well. Its weight – shifting and balance – based stands strengthen the muscles around the joints. Take the lunch – like positions in tai chi. They work on the leg muscles, making them stronger. Stronger muscles provide better support to the joints,allowing arthritis patients to move around more freely and with less assistance.

Is Tai Chi Safe for Arthritis?

One of the great things about tai chi is its safety for arthritis patients. Unlike high – impact exercises Tai Chi Classes Online , tai chi places minimal stress on the joints. The smooth and continuous movements don't cause sudden jolts or impacts. Even if you have severe arthritis, you can usually adjust the postures to suit your joint condition. So, you can enjoy the benefits of exercise Without fear of further damaging your joints.

What Are the Mental Benefits of Tai Chi?

t ai chi for arthritis

Arthritis isn't just a physical condition; it takes a toll on mental health too. Tai chi's meditative aspect helps in reducing stress and anxiety. When you focus on the slow movements and your breath, you enter a state of relaxation. Stress can exacerbate arthritis symptoms, so by reducing stress, tai chi indirectly helps in better arthritis management. I've seen students who were initially very depressed due to their arthritis start to have a more positive outlook on life after practicing tai chi.

How Often Should You Do Tai Chi for Arthritis?

Consistency is key when it comes to tai chi for arthritis. Doing a few sessions a week can have a cumulative effect. For optimal results, aim for at least three to four sessions per week. Each session doesn't have to be long; even 20 – 30 minutes can make a difference. As you progress, you can gradually increase the duration and intensity of your practice.

Chen Style Tai Chi: The Origin Of All Tai Chi Forms With Long – Standing History And Unique Charm!

Chen style tai chi forms have long – standing history and unique charm. They're full of power,with softness hiding strength Tai Chi And Diabetes Courses Online , and are a precious part of traditional Chinese martial arts.

What is Chen Style Tai Chi?

Chen style tai chi is the origin of all tai chi forms. It was created by the Chen family in Chenjiagou, Henan. It combines the essence of traditional Chinese culture and martial arts. Its movements are spiral and circular, with obvious silk – reeling energy. The postures are changeable, full of power and flexibility, like a dragon winding and a snake twisting.

Benefits of Practicing

chen style tai chi forms

Practicing Chen style tai chi forms can bring many benefits. Physically, it helps improve flexibility, strengthen muscles, and enhance the cardiopulmonary function. Mentally, it trains concentration and patience. It's like a natural tranquilizer, calming the mind in the hustle and bustle of life. Many people who start practicing find their sleep and mood improve.

Training Difficulties

Of course, learning Chen style tai chi forms isn't easy. The complex and changeable movements require a long – time study. The control of silk – reeling energy is also a challenge. Beginners may feel it hard to master the correct postures and rhythms. It's like walking on a tightrope, needing to balance every movement precisely.

How to Learn Effectively?

chen style tai chi forms

To learn effectively, it's important to have a good teacher. A teacher can correct your postures and guide you. Also, regular practice is essential. Set aside some time every day to practice. You can also watch video tutorials to learn from masters. It's like building a house, step by step, laying a solid foundation.

What Are The Characteristics Of Chen's 36-style Tai Chi? What Are The Benefits Of Practicing It?

Chen's 36-style Tai Chi is a representative routine in traditional Tai Chi, which concentrates on the core characteristics of Chen's Tai Chi. Its moves have both a strong side and a gentle side. The combination of speed and slowness can not only calm the heart, but also help strengthen physical fitness. Next, each of its components will be analyzed in detail.

Features of Chen's 36-style Tai Chi

Chen's 36-style Tai Chi style has a unique style, and it emphasizes the use of winding power. It uses the waist as the center to drive the limbs to rotate, which is as continuous as silk threads wrap around. The transition between hardness and softness in the movement is very clear. When exerting force, the force is vigorous, like a tiger going down a mountain; when accumulating force is gentle and slow, like the spring breeze blowing on the face. This characteristic of combining hardness and softness allows practitioners to experience the mystery of Tai Chi in the transformation of movement and stillness.

What to pay attention to in training

When practicing Chen’s 36 Tai Chi, you should pay attention to the coordination of breath and body shape. When inhaling, the body tightens slightly; when exhaling, the body stretches and loosens. Also pay attention to the place where you practice and choose a place where you have clean and quiet air. In addition, avoid being too tired. The length and intensity of each exercise must be set according to your personal physical condition. If you feel uncomfortable during practice, you should stop immediately.
